BCS Rankings: Oklahoma State Prove They Must Play for National Championship

Alex KayDec 4, 2011

The Oklahoma State Cowboys proved to everyone last night that they are the second best team in the nation and deserve to play LSU in the BCS Championship Game.

After they destroyed their biggest rival and the No. 10 team in the BCS rankings (the Oklahoma Sooners), it became clear that the Pokes need to play for the national title.

44-10 was the final score of the signature win the Pokes needed to cap their season off to take the highly competitive Big 12.

As champions of the second strongest conference in football, it would be stupid for Oklahoma State not to play the champions of the so-called strongest, the SEC.

Why should Alabama get a chance to rematch LSU when they already lost and didn’t even play in the SEC title game? They haven’t done enough to earn it.

The computers actually might get this right and should have the Pokes ranked No. 2, so now it’s up to voters to pick the right team to play LSU.

They just got a refresher last night that the choice is obviously the Bedlam winner.

Coach Mike Gundy also said so himself:

He proclaimed on the field that "there's no question Oklahoma State should be No. 2 right now."

"The honest answer is we didn't deserve it. We do now," Gundy said. "And if we'd have won this game 17-14, I don't know if I'd have said it...When you win by 34 points, we deserve the right."

The right he is talking about is playing in the national championship game. And he’s absolutely right: his Cowboys are the team most deserving of the No. 2 ranking tonight and should be given the chance to play LSU.
